How to reduce wrinkles

How to reduce wrinkles

When people get old, their skin becomes loose and many people will develop many wrinkles. However, it is not only the elderly who have wrinkles, many young people also have wrinkles. Wrinkles have a great impact on the appearance of the human body. Therefore, people hope to take some measures to reduce wrinkles after they appear. So how can we reduce wrinkles? Let's introduce it in detail below.

The first thing is to pay attention to sun protection, because once the skin is exposed to the sun, the facial skin will age faster and the wrinkles will be more obvious, so you must pay attention to sun protection.

It is also best to apply a facial mask once a week to replenish moisture to the skin. This will make the facial skin smoother and more supple, and it will be less likely to develop wrinkles.

Secondly, you can try chewing gum, which will keep the facial muscles moving and prevent wrinkles.

The next thing is to replenish water in time. Drinking more water can prevent the water in the body from being lost quickly, so it will not be easy to dry out. This is very important.

Then you need to supplement more collagen. As you age, the loss of collagen in your face will cause you to look much older, and wrinkles will appear. You can eat some pig's trotters appropriately.

Currently, the simpler and more effective way to remove wrinkles is to use botulinum toxin. Botulinum toxin is currently the safest and most effective method both domestically and internationally, and it has a relatively definite effect with very few side effects. Generally speaking, the effect will be seen soon after the injection. In particular, some patients are worried about problems such as stiff facial expressions after injecting botulinum toxin. In fact, the current injection theory requires a reduction in the dosage. The dosage of botulinum toxin injections is getting smaller and smaller, and precise injection is required, which can minimize complications of facial stiffness and achieve very good results. For wrinkles that have already formed dead folds, a combination of treatments is sometimes used: Botox is injected first, and then after it disappears, which is about a month later, if there are still some obvious dead folds, hyaluronic acid fillings can be done, which has a better supplementary and corrective effect on the wrinkles.
